Re: New RC10 Rear tower design...
Good rule of thumb for engineering purposes on most materials. When cutting material around a hole- If the material is the same thickness as the diameter of the hole being drilled leave at least one hole diameter of material on all sides of the hole. So, if you have 1/8th inch thick material, and you are drilling an 1/8th inch hole, the cross section thru the hole to both sides of the material should be no less than 3/8th of an inch. If the material is thinner, increase the cros sectional area to accomodate. Also you should never have any square inside corners (like in your rear tower). They will focus and magnify stress and be a point of fracture. Always radius your corners. This is not much of an issue on cnc routed stuff like mine, as the machining leaves natural raduises. Otherwise, it looks like a good start. Good luck -Jeff

Re: New RC10 Rear tower design...
Also, I understand what you are saying about the shorter rear B4.1 shocks being offeres by AE, and a tower for them. It might be a good idea. I haven't looked into them, but I do wonder about the decrease (if any) in travel. With the B4.1 the car has much longer arms than the std RC10. This allows as a shorter shock to be used and maintain travel. The std RC10 benefits from a longer shock because it need a greater range of motion to maintain its suspension travel. I am using the V2 shocks on another one of my cars, and if memory serves I have limiters in the rear. It may well be that the B4.1 shocks work just fine on the rear of the std RC10. I don't have them to check, but maybe one of the mambers here does... -Jeff

Re: New RC10 Rear tower design...
on the rpm bulkhead, they use 2 different upper shock tower mounting locations. instead of being up an towards the center like a standard bulkhead, they're positioned above the lower holes. so to use any kind of rc10 tower (besides an rpm and i believe fiberlyte), 2 new holes need to be drilled.
so more or less, all you need to do to your tower is take out the dish section on both sides of your tower and make it go straight up and down. then if someone wanted to use your tower on an rpm bulkhead, they can drill the 2 holes themself.
or, they could just grow a pair and drill 2 holes in the rpm bulkhead and use your tower as designed.
